What text-based adventure games do you recommend?
What text-based adventure games do you recommend?
The King of Shreds and Patches is probably the first text adventure I managed to finish. It has a memorable plot (Shakespeare vs. Cthulhu!), fun investigative gameplay, and a modern design style (with an automap, a quest log, no dead-ends, etc.). And it’s free! I can’t think of a more obvious recommendation.
If you’re feeling ambitious, Hadean Lands is a game design masterpiece. It is very complex, and quite challenging, but in a fair way.
Thaumistry: In Charm’s Way is great fun to play.
